In this paper, an ESR continuous casting system was introduced. The consumable electrode was transmitted alternately with two sets of nut-screw pair, each transmission pair equipped clamp-on gripper. The system controlled under a combination of single-chip microcomputer and programmable logical controller. With automatic control circuit and sensors, the consumable electrode can achieve continuous, automatic feed alternatively. Practical application shows that the system is stable and reliable, and electrode feed smoothly, casting current is steady. Through the use of special mould, complex electroslag castings can be cast out.
